What to feed an adult Laika dog?

What to feed an adult Laika dog? - briefly

An adult Laika dog should be fed a balanced diet consisting of high-quality protein sources such as lean meat or fish, combined with whole grains and vegetables. It is essential to avoid foods that can be harmful to dogs, such as chocolate, onions, and grapes, to ensure their health and well-being.

What to feed an adult Laika dog? - in detail

An adult Laika dog, known for its high energy levels and active lifestyle, requires a balanced and nutritious diet to maintain overall health and well-being. Proper nutrition is essential for supporting their muscular frame, ensuring optimal digestion, and promoting a glossy coat. It's crucial to provide a diet that meets the specific needs of this breed while considering individual variations in metabolism and activity levels.

To begin with, adult Laika dogs should be fed high-quality dog food that is specifically formulated for their size and energy requirements. High-protein content is essential as it supports muscle development and maintenance. Look for dog foods that list meat or fish as the primary ingredients, ensuring a sufficient amount of animal protein. Additionally, the diet should include a balance of carbohydrates, fats, vitamins, and minerals to support overall health.

When selecting a dog food brand, opt for reputable manufacturers that adhere to strict quality control measures. Avoid foods with excessive fillers such as corn or wheat, which can contribute to digestive issues. Instead, choose foods rich in whole grains like brown rice and oats, which provide necessary fiber and nutrients.

In addition to commercial dog food, you can supplement your Laika's diet with fresh ingredients. Lean proteins such as chicken, turkey, or fish are excellent choices. These should be cooked thoroughly to eliminate any potential bacteria. Vegetables like carrots, spinach, and sweet potatoes can also be introduced in moderation, offering additional vitamins and fiber. However, it's important to avoid feeding your dog foods that are toxic to dogs, such as onions, garlic, grapes, and chocolate.

Hydration is another vital aspect of a Laika's diet. Ensure your dog has access to clean, fresh water at all times. This is particularly important during periods of high activity or in hot weather conditions. Dehydration can lead to various health issues, so monitoring water intake is crucial.

Regular exercise and a consistent feeding schedule are also key components of maintaining a healthy adult Laika dog. Feed your dog at the same time each day, typically twice a day for adults. This routine helps regulate their digestive system and prevents overeating. Additionally, provide ample opportunities for physical activity to complement their diet and support their natural instincts as working dogs.

Lastly, it's essential to monitor your Laika's weight and adjust the food portions accordingly. Overfeeding can lead to obesity, which puts additional strain on their joints and overall health. Consult with a veterinarian for personalized advice tailored to your dog's specific needs, including any dietary restrictions or supplements that may be necessary.

By providing a well-balanced diet, maintaining proper hydration, and ensuring regular exercise, you can help ensure that your adult Laika dog remains healthy, active, and happy for many years to come.
